HELP! - bleeding hydraulic clutch
Okay, Saturday I re-installed my rekluse clutch but had one issue. My dad accidentally pumped the clutch while I had things disassembled - pushed the throw-out rod quite a ways out. Installed rekluse, but it wouldn't engage as the throw-out rod was pushed out. Couldn't pull in the clutch lever either as there was too much pressure. I cracked the bleeder on the slave cylinder, but must have got air in the line as I now have no feel at the lever. Never bled a hydraulic clutch before - is it the same as a brake? I will have to pull the slave cylinder off the bike as actuating the clutch override on a rekluse with the engine shutoff is a big nono. Tips? Thanks,
